Transaction cd80d609a16471a6f29214c23591753bde963958a84c7d2904a539141b165c78
1 Input
1 Output
-
cd80d609a16471a6f29214c23591753bde963958a84c7d2904a539141b165c78:0
- value
- 98896136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fe1218b35d5a17462a8ebe3d9ed8ddcb5993f97 OP_EQUAL
- address
- 3N6nJhZbULpjtb9ZhoL78btEqf1w2wuneH